Swyx's
new products include: SwyxWare Compact is a fully featured,
an "all-in-one" pure IP-PBX telephony solution targeted
specifically at small businesses with up to 10 users. Designed
to operate on Windows® XP Professional or Windows Server,
the SwyxWare Compact incorporates all of the major features
of SwyxWare that a small business could need, including voicemail/email
integration, Microsoft ™ Outlook ™/Lotus ™
Notes ™ support with Click-to-Dial capability, CTI features,
enhanced system call routing and call handling functionality
(e.g IVR, follow-me, helpdesk and programmable call-handling
functions), individual call routing that can be linked to
calendar/diary, fax capability for all users linked to the
inbox, individual call recording capability, teleworking facility
with remote access, and SIP and ISDN trunking capabilities
for connection to traditional telephony or VoIP providers.
Designed to operate with Swyx IP phones, SIP phones or SwyxIt!
Softphones, Compact will allow small businesses to easily
implement and benefit from a business-class pure IP telephony
solution in terms of increasing productivity, user mobility
and cost savings.
SwyxConnect
is an innovative and comprehensive "full service"
branch solution that enables a SwyxWare installation to be
extended to smaller subsidiary or remote branch offices, making
it possible to either replace the current branch telephony
infrastructure with a SwyxWare IP PBX solution, or to carry
on using an existing PBX telephone system or legacy handsets
in conjunction with SwyxWare to gain the benefits of a Swyx
IP telephony solution. Existing ISDN or analogue terminals
can be utilised as SwyxWare or SIP telephones to a Swyx or
VoIP SIP network, enabling users to benefit from VoIP and
Swyx's class-leading IP PBX featureset whilst still protecting
their investment in legacy infrastructure. In addition, SwyxConnect
also boasts advanced networking and gateway functions to the
branch data network, offering business-class routing, secure
VPN, security/firewall/intrusion detection and "lifeline"
capabilities to ensure a comprehensive branch communications
solution for the small office. SwyxConnect also boasts standalone
voice routing capabilities for local PSTN breakout or call
routing, and with an integrated SIP proxy and SIP client support,
will allow small offices to utilise local routing capabilities
to a PSTN or VoIP provider.
SwyxIt!
Now is a standalone SIP-based VoIP telephony application
that can be used by consumers and business users alike to
improve their experience and familiarity with Internet Telephony.
Based on the class-leading SwyxWare IP Telephony platform,
SwyxIt! Now uses SIP technology to offer users a highly-featured,
standalone SIP client that offers business telephony features
normally only found on telephone systems sold to high-end
businesses, and delivers a strong, software-based alternative
to users considering using lower-quality consumer-based VoIP
services or new peer-to-peer hardware-based solutions from
traditional telephony vendors.
SwyxIt!
Now will also provide users with a number of features
that they are already familiar with from their mobile or business
telephone: local personal address books, caller ID support,
re-dial support and caller-programmable ringtones, as well
as traditional SwyxWare features such as Microsoft™
Outlook™ & Lotus™ Notes™ integration
& Click-to-Dial, call recording, and call routing/forwarding
features. As a standalone client, it will support SIP Proxy
registration or operate in peer-to-peer mode, and boasts MS-TAPI,
STUN and ENUM support, enabling it to be used in conjunction
with SwyxConnect to deliver a strong, small office/branch
SIP VoIP solution. For Systems Integrators and Service Providers,
it also boasts an easy-to-implement 'skin design' system to
offer company-branded or personalised skin designs.
SwyxWare
6.0 is the successor of SwyxWare 5.01, and continues
to focus both on the small-medium enterprise (SME) markets
and larger Enterprise market segments for its market-leading
SwyxWare range of products. New for 6.0 are two new versions
of SwyxWare, SwyxWare Essential and SwyxWare Professional.
SwyxWare
Essential is an entry-level product targeted at SME
and Enterprise businesses who require only a standard IP PBX
featureset, and is a scalable solution which will support
from 5 concurrent users to many thousands of users based on
SwyxWare’s unique Software licensing system. Essential
offers SwyxWare's base IP PBX featureset, with the ability
to add a number of configurable options to the platform, including
Voicemail & Email integration, Fax integration, CTI support,
enhanced Call Routing & IVR, Call Recording/Intrusion,
Conference Server/Rooms and enhanced billing/call detail recording
(CDR) options.
SwyxWare
Professional is a full-service product that boasts
all of the key feature option packages as standard for all
users, and will attract customers who prefer to opt for a
uniform & full functionality featureset for their businesses.
Additional key features for Version 6.0 include multi-site
and multi-location gateway support, Standby Server and additional
Business Resilience options, support for executive/call intrusion,
enhanced administration and provisioning support and enhancements
for SIP functionality and support.
